How much do junior net developer j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 13, 2026, the average hourly pay for junior net developer in Georgia is $31.37,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$23.94 and $36.15 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Junior .NET Develop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Junior .NET Developer, you need a solid understanding of C#, .NET frameworks, and basic software development principles, typically demonstrated by a relevant degree or coursework. Familiarity with Visual Studio, SQL Server, version control systems like Git, and possibly Microsoft Certified: .NET Fundamentals certification is beneficial. Strong problem-solving skills, attention to detail, and effective communication help you collaborate with team members and adapt to new technologies. These skills and qualifications are crucial for delivering maintainable, efficient software and contributing effectively to development projects.

What are Junior Net Developers?

Junior Net Developers are entry-level software professionals who specialize in building and maintaining applications using Microsoft’s .NET framework. They typically work under the supervision of more experienced developers and assist in coding, debugging, testing, and deploying software solutions. Their responsibilities often include writing clean and scalable code, participating in code reviews, and learning best practices for software development. Junior Net Developers usually have a basic understanding of C#, ASP.NET, and related technologies, and are eager to grow their skills within a team environment.

What are some common challenges faced by Junior .NET Developers during their first year on the job?

Junior .NET Developers often encounter challenges such as adapting to legacy codebases, understanding company-specific development workflows, and keeping up with rapidly evolving technologies within the .NET ecosystem. Collaboration with more experienced team members can also be daunting, especially when participating in code reviews or agile meetings. However, most teams foster a supportive environment and provide mentorship, making it easier for newcomers to grow their technical and problem-solving skills.
